U13’s Top Off Fantastic Year With County Final Success
On Thursday night last our U13 Footballers travelled to Mick Neville Park to take on Ahane in the Division 2 Championship County Final. The Dromcollogher/ Broadford side started the game very well moving the ball from attack to defence getting a few vital scores to leave the score at half time Dromcollogher/ Broadford 1-4 to Ahane 2 points. The second half came down to a battle with Ahane attacking in waves, with Dromcollogher/ Broadford finding it very difficult to get the ball up the field by getting a goal mid into the second half. Ahamed got the score down to a two-point game with six minutes remaining, Dromcollogher/ Broadford defence held their nerves to come away with a mighty victory to claim a county title for these courageous players. The final scoreline on the night was Dromcollogher/ Broadford 2-4 to Ahane 1-5. This was a brilliant achievement for these bunch of players which they will remember for the rest of their lives.
